Getting Started with Amazon Web Services (AWS): A Beginner-Friendly Guide
Amazon Web Services (AWS) is a cloud computing platform that has transformed the way businesses and individuals build, deploy, and manage applications and services. If you're new to AWS and looking to dive into the world of cloud computing, you're in the right place. In this blog, we will take you through the basics of AWS simply and interactively so that everyone can understand.
What Is AWS?
Imagine having the ability to access powerful computing resources, storage, and various services on the internet. AWS makes this possible. AWS offers a wide range of cloud-based services, including computing power, databases, storage, machine learning, and more. This means you can run your applications or host your websites without the need to invest in physical hardware.
Setting Up Your AWS Account
The first step to getting started with AWS is to create an AWS account. Here's how you can do it:
Visit the AWS website: Go to the AWS website (https://aws.amazon.com/).
Click 'Create an AWS Account': You'll find this option at the top right corner of the page.
Follow the Sign-Up Process: You'll be guided through a series of steps, including providing your contact information and payment details. Don't worry; AWS offers a free tier with limited usage to help you get started without incurring any costs.
Verification: AWS will send you a verification code to the email address you provided. Enter this code to verify your account.
AWS Services
AWS offers a vast array of services, and it can be overwhelming at first. Here are some essential AWS services to know:
Amazon EC2 (Elastic Compute Cloud): This is where you can create virtual machines (known as instances) to run your applications.
Amazon S3 (Simple Storage Service): S3 allows you to store and retrieve data, making it perfect for hosting static websites and data backups.
Amazon RDS (Relational Database Service): RDS offers managed database services like MySQL, PostgreSQL, and more.
AWS Lambda: Lambda lets you run code without provisioning or managing servers. It's excellent for creating serverless applications.
Amazon VPC (Virtual Private Cloud): VPC allows you to create isolated networks within the AWS cloud.
The AWS Management Console
Once you have your AWS account, you can access the AWS Management Console. This is the web interface where you can manage and use AWS services. To access the console:
Log In: Go to the AWS website and click 'Sign in to the Console.'
Enter Your Credentials: Provide your email and password.
Select a Region: AWS has data centers in different regions worldwide. Choose the region closest to you or your target audience.
Why Aws is a Market Leader?
Early Mover Advantage: AWS was one of the first major players in the cloud computing space, launching its services in 2006. This head start allowed AWS to build a robust infrastructure and gain a significant market share before many of its competitors even entered the market.
Global Infrastructure: AWS boasts an extensive global network of data centers in multiple regions around the world. This global presence allows businesses to deploy their applications and services close to their end-users, improving performance and reducing latency.
Wide Range of Services: AWS offers a comprehensive suite of cloud services that cater to a diverse set of needs. Whether you're looking for computing power, storage, databases, machine learning, IoT, or analytics, AWS has a service to address those requirements.
Innovation and Agility: AWS is known for its continuous innovation. It regularly introduces new services and features, which keeps it at the forefront of technology. This enables businesses to leverage cutting-edge solutions.
Scalability: AWS provides scalable infrastructure and services, making it an ideal choice for startups and enterprises alike. Users can easily scale up or down based on their needs, which is crucial for businesses with fluctuating workloads.
Reliability and Security: AWS places a strong emphasis on reliability and security. It provides a highly available infrastructure with redundancy and data replication, along with a robust set of security features to protect data and applications.
Ecosystem and Marketplace: AWS has a vast ecosystem of partners, developers, and third-party integrations, allowing users to extend and customize their cloud infrastructure. The AWS Marketplace offers a wide variety of pre-built software solutions.
Enterprise Adoption: Many large enterprises, government organizations, and startups rely on AWS for their cloud computing needs. Its enterprise-level services and compliance certifications make it a trusted choice for organizations with rigorous requirements.
Cost Management: AWS provides various tools and features to help users manage their costs effectively. This includes services like AWS Cost Explorer and Budgets, which help businesses control their cloud spending.
Exceptional Support: AWS offers multiple levels of customer support, including premium options like AWS Premium Support. This support ensures that businesses have access to assistance when needed.
Educational Resources: AWS provides extensive documentation, tutorials, and training through AWS Academy, making it easy for individuals and teams to learn and become proficient in using their services.
Community and User Groups: AWS has a strong community with user groups, forums, and events. This fosters collaboration, knowledge sharing, and support among users.
๐ Thank you so much for reading my blog! ๐ I hope you found it helpful and informative. If you did, please ๐ give it a like and ๐ subscribe to my newsletter for more of this type of content. ๐
I'm always looking for ways to improve my blog, so please feel free to leave me a comment or suggestion. ๐ฌ
Thanks again for your support! ๐